ADVISORY: UPDATED INFORMATION ON
'CHEVRON SKY' OIL SPILL IN SAN FRANCISCO BAY
SAN FRANCISCO, Dec. 31 /PRNewswire/ -- Cleanup equipment and personnel from Chevron, the U.S. Coast Guard and the Clean Bay cleanup cooperative are on the scene of the "Chevron Sky" working to assess the extent of a small oil spill on the Bay and clean up the oil as quickly as possible.
The Sky is located just off Hunter's Point at an area known as Anchorage 9. The spill is located just south of the Bay Bridge.
